WebApr 24, 2024 · Broadly speaking, there are two main sides to the cultural imitation debate: those who argue that it is offensive and culturally insensitive, and those who contend that it is a show of admiration. Appropriation is the intentional borrowing, copying, and alteration of existing images and objects.
